In article <address@hidden>, Juri Linkov <address@hidden> writes:

> Since a list of necessary Unicode characters is too large and it is
> not limited to Cyrillic, what do you think about creating a new
> input method that could be activated simultaneously with language
> specific input method?  In case of conflicting rules we could specify
> the priority by using the order of active input methods e.g.
> "unicode-map,cyrillic-translit" vs "cyrillic-translit,unicode-map"
> in a new variable like `quail-additional-input-methods'.

I remember that activating multiple input methods was
discussed a while ago on this list, but don't remember the
conclusion.

Unfortunately, I don't have a time to implement it at the
moment.  If there's someone who want to work on it, I'm
gladly help him.
